3 Key Factors to Avoid Mistakes
Don’t underestimate power spec matching—it’s winter’s safe power backbone.
- Check total wattage: Your device’s rated wattage must exceed connected gear. PLUGTUL’s 1625W 16AWG cord handles lamps/chargers, while 1875W 14AWG strips tackle space heaters.
- Gauge counts: Lower AWG = thicker wires. 14AWG for heavy use, 16AWG for daily electronics.
- Always pick ETL-listed products—they meet strict safety/fire-resistance standards.

PLUGTUL's Safe Practices for Winter
- Avoid overloading: Never plug more devices than the product’s rated capacity. For example, don’t pair a high-wattage heater with multiple other appliances on a single extension cord.
- Keep cords away from hazards: Ensure cords aren’t crushed under furniture, tangled, or placed near water (like humidifier spills) or heat sources.
- Unplug when not in use: Save energy and reduce fire risk by disconnecting extension cords and power strips when you’re not working—especially overnight.
- Inspect regularly: Check for frayed wires, loose plugs, or overheating. Stop using immediately if you notice any damage.
